Drilling Confirms Continuity of Large-Scale Mineralized System & Delivers New Discovery Toronto, Ontario--(Newsfile Corp. - June 15, 2026) - AbraSilver Resource Corp. (TSX: ABRA) (OTCQX: ABBRF) ("AbraSilver" or the "Company") is pleased to report assay results from the 2026 drill program at the La Coipita copper-gold-molybdenum project ("La Coipita" or the "Project") located in the San Juan Province of Argentina. The drill program is fully funded and operated by a subsidiary of Teck Resources Limited ("Teck") under the terms of the earn-in and joint venture agreement, as per the Company's news release dated January 22, 2024 . The 2026 program comprised 5,248 metres ("m") of diamond drilling across seven holes (DDH-LC26-010 through DDH-LC26-016), designed to test the limits and vertical continuity of known mineralization at the Yaretas target and evaluate new targets generated by the first-ever magnetotelluric ("MT") geophysical survey completed across the property.
Key Highlights Hole DDH-LC26-010 returned the strongest drill intercept recorded to date at La Coipita: 747.5 m grading 0.69% Cu, 0.06 g/t Au and 142 ppm Mo , from 396 m to 1,143.5 m down-hole depth, confirming the presence of a robust and vertically extensive copper-gold-molybdenum system. Including: 108 m at 1.06% Cu, 0.10 g/t Au and 204 ppm Mo, from 396 to 504 m; 184 m at 0.78% Cu, 0.09 g/t Au and 123 ppm Mo, from 604 to 788 m Hole DDH-LC26-011 returned 250.6 m at 0.39% Cu, 0.07 g/t Au and 119 ppm Mo, from 550 to 800.6 m. This hole confirmed continuity of mineralization between previously reported holes DDHC-22-002 and DDH-LC25-006 (see Figures 1 and 2), further strengthening confidence in the scale and continuity of the Yaretas system.
